Curriculum Vitae (CV)

Antonio Togni has been Full Professor of Organometallic Chemistry at the Laboratory of Inorganic Chemistry of the ETH Zurich since April 1, 1999; he was previously Associate Professor in the same discipline.

Prof. Togni was born on January 14, 1956. He studied chemistry at the ETH Zurich where he earned his doctorate 1983 under Professor L. M. Venanzi with a dissertation on dinuclear hydrido complexes. He then transferred to the California Institute of Technology, Pasadena, for a period of postdoctoral research under Professor J.E. Bercaw.

In 1985 he joined the staff of the Central Research Laboratories of Ciba Geigy, where he worked on asymmetric catalysis. He returned to the ETH in 1992 as an Assistant Professor. His research interests focus on asymmetric homogeneous catalysis and organofluorine chemistry.
